Manufacturing overhead costs allocated to a job amounted to $491,000.The actual manufacturing costs incurred during the year were $580,000.Overhead costs have been underallocated.


Definitions:

Net Markdowns

The total decrease in the selling price of merchandise over a period, minus any markdown cancellations or recoveries.

Freight-in Charges

Costs incurred in bringing inventory to its present location and condition, typically including transportation charges.

LIFO Retail Inventory Method

An inventory costing method that assumes the last items placed in inventory are sold first, not necessarily reflecting the actual physical flow of merchandise.

Ending Inventory

The value of goods available for sale at the end of an accounting period, calculated as the beginning inventory plus purchases minus cost of goods sold.
